ChatGPT on Mac now includes new controls for Apple's iMessage. This feature allows the OpenAI system to read, write, and send text messages. It can also search messages and summarize conversations from the Apple Messages app. What's interesting is that this development could raise privacy questions. Apple has strongly emphasized user privacy, especially concerning message content. An OpenAI tool that might upload Apple customer data to its network is likely to be scrutinized. OpenAI stated that the feature requires user consent and does not create an index of all messages. The tool runs locally on the Mac, using existing operating system tools like AppleScript. Users will see permission screens in both the ChatGPT app and Apple's operating system when setting up this integration, indicating that on-device message history will be accessed.
